What the white card really is

The white card is the national credential that reveals you have completed the device CPCWHS1001 Prepare to function securely in the building sector. In Queensland, consisting of the Gold Coast, registered training organisations provide the training and provide the card under the authority of Work Health and Safety Queensland. It is nationally recognised, so a card gained in Queensland is valid for work in New South Wales, Victoria, and the rest of Australia.

Despite the uniform name, you do not obtain a permit to operate tools or machinery. It is an entry-level safety induction, developed to aid you identify threats, connect, and take basic, efficient action prior to a little problem ends up being an incident. Think of it as the baseline that every person on site shares, from first-year apprentice to site manager.

What the regulation expects in Queensland

On the Gold Coast, the requirement originates from the Job Health and Safety Policy 2011. Anyone doing building work must hold a general building and construction induction training card prior to starting. Employers, primary specialists, and labour hire companies also have a task to validate that you have existing evidence.

Two practical factors issue on the ground:

    The card has no official expiration. However, if you have actually refrained construction help 2 or even more successive years, Queensland anticipates you to complete the training once more prior to you go back to site. I have had employees from friendliness rejoin the trades after a break and assume their old cards were great. They were not. The white card does not change site-specific inductions. Despite having a fresh card, you will still endure a home builder's own induction, typically covering accessibility guidelines, site format, permits, and emergency treatments. One does not alternative to the other.

Face to encounter, online, or crossbreed on the Gold Coast

A lot of individuals search for white card online Gold Coast due to the fact that it seems convenient. Below is the fact in Queensland:

    Self paced, "click following" on-line training courses are not appropriate for releasing a Queensland white card. The regulatory authority expects actual interaction with a fitness instructor and assessment of practical skills. Many carriers now offer online virtual classrooms, generally provided by video clip meeting with identification checks, supervised assessments, and camera-on participation. When supplied by a Queensland‑approved signed up training organisation, this can be legit. If the supplier states you can complete it without talking to a fitness instructor, that is a red flag. Traditional face‑to‑face courses are commonly available from Southport to Tweed-adjacent residential areas, frequently running mornings, afternoons, or Saturdays. If your English is still establishing or you find out best with hands-on guidance, in‑person white card training Gold Coast QLD stays the more secure bet.

If you are unsure, ask the provider candidly: will my white card be released for Queensland, and is the program distribution technique accepted by WHSQ? Trusted white card Gold Coast training teams will certainly address that directly and direct you to their RTO number.

What the course covers and why it is not fluff

I usually hear, "It is just a day in a classroom." True, a basic white card course Gold Coast runs in a solitary day, but the good ones focus on the threats that actually hurt individuals right here: drops from elevation, traffic movement around real-time websites, electrical power, excavation, and hands-on handling.

The core end results ought to include:

    Understanding basic lawful duties. You will certainly listen to the term PCBU, which is business or individual performing an organization or endeavor. On website, that normally implies your employer, the primary contractor, or both. You still have obligations as an employee to adhere to guidelines, use PPE, and report hazards. Identifying and regulating dangers. An usual exercise is to check a mock site image that includes unprotected edges, routing leads, and missing guards, after that go through the hierarchy of control. If you avoid directly to "put on handwear covers," a good fitness instructor will push you to consider removal, substitution, seclusion, and engineering control first. Communicating efficiently. You will certainly exercise reporting and appointment, including exactly how to raise a stop-work if something is unacceptably high-risk. I have seen brand-new labourers prevent speaking up regarding a wobbly trestle until they learned the right language and the assumption that they should utilize it. Using PPE correctly. It appears minor, but inadequate fit or wrong selection defeats the purpose. The course ought to cover picking the ideal glove for solvents, when hearing security actually lowers threat, and how to inspect a construction hat's service life. Emergency reaction. Muster points, website maps, evacuation signals, and the fundamentals of initial feedback till assistance shows up. On coastal sites, storms roll through rapidly. Understanding where to go and who to call is not academic.

Time, cost, and the genuine routine pressure

Across white card programs Gold Coast, anticipate 6 to 7 hours of organized training and evaluation. Some carriers promote much shorter periods, yet if you listen to "carried out in two hours," keep your cash in your pocket. Compliant delivery needs a mix of concept, discussion, and practical tasks.

Fees on the Gold Coast usually fall in between 80 and 120 dollars. Team bookings for companies often been available in a touch lower. If a course is pitched well under the marketplace average, ask what is missing: is PPE supplied, are assessments performed live, and is shipping for the physical card included?

Timing issues. If you are starting a new work on Monday, do not schedule a Sunday evening session and expect a wonder. Companies usually accept a Statement of Achievement or an interim certificate on the day, however only if it plainly reveals CPCWHS1001 and the RTO information. The plastic card generally gets here by message in 1 to 3 weeks.

What the analysis looks like

Assessment is not an exam in the college feeling. It is a mix of short-answer concerns, oral questioning, and simple practical demos. You may be asked online white card Gold Coast to:

    Identify hazards in a circumstance image and describe the best control procedures, not just PPE. Put on and readjust PPE properly, consisting of inspecting glasses rest appropriately and that hearing security develops a seal. Fill out a standard event or danger report form with enough information that a supervisor might act. Explain what you would do if scaffolding is identified out or if you are asked to work at height without fall protection. Interpret website indications and illustrations at a basic degree, such as identifying exclusion areas or live services.

A good fitness instructor does not try to deceive you. If you obtain a response wrong, they will usually ask a follow-up to see whether you can correct yourself with a nudge. The aim is capacity on a real-time website, not rote memory.

Common snags Gold Coast employees run into

Mismatch in between USI and ID names delays issuance greater than anything else. Utilize your full legal name for both. Nicknames and missing out on center names produce back-and-forth e-mails you do not need.

Overconfidence injures. Experienced tradies sometimes shore with and miss modifications in legislation or best technique. The last few years have actually pushed stronger consultation duties and more clear policies around silica dust control. Listen, ask what has actually changed since your last site.

Assuming interstate on the internet cards will pass. Some carriers release a basic induction card from one more jurisdiction using completely on the internet, self-paced components. Queensland websites and major building contractors frequently refuse those. If the work gets on the Gold Coast, gain a Gold Coast white card through a Queensland‑compliant course.

Turning up without basic PPE. You will certainly still complete the theory, but you could fall short sensible parts or obtain rescheduled. If unsure, ask the RTO what to bring.

Recognition across Australia

Once you hold a Queensland-issued white card, you can deal with tasks in Brisbane, Sydney, Melbourne, or Adelaide without retraining, provided you have remained active in building and construction. Some firms have added inner inductions, especially in heavy market or rail passages, but the white card itself is recognised.

Losing, damaging, or needing to upgrade your card

Things happen. Purses go missing, cards thaw in utes, and addresses modification. Your very first stop is the RTO that issued the card. They can normally organize a replacement and will certainly tell you whether they or WHSQ process it. If the original RTO has actually closed, contact Work Health and Safety Queensland with your Declaration of Attainment or any proof of concern. Fees are small, and substitute cards typically arrive within a number of weeks.

If your lawful name has altered, upgrade your USI and ID initially, after that talk to the RTO so your documents align. Keeping those information right prevents delays following time a service provider audits credentials.

After you get your white card: the very first week on site

Carry your card or, at minimum, a clear picture of it and your Statement of Attainment. Most gain access to control systems currently accept an electronic copy, but some primary contractors still intend to sight the original on day one.

Expect a site-specific induction concentrated on the real work. On coastal high-rise jobs, you will certainly find out about exclusion zones under crane loads, wind thresholds, and lift shaft controls. On residential work west of the highway, you will certainly listen to more concerning trenching, overhead lines, and silica controls when reducing crafted stone or tiles. Ask questions, also straightforward ones. It reveals you are activated and keeps you in the loop.

Take SWMS seriously. You will certainly be asked to review and sign Safe Job Technique Statements, not skim them. If a job changes, say so. I remember a kind employee explaining that the planned edge security differed from the SWMS once the deck layout moved. Since he spoke up, the group stopped briefly, mounted a short-lived guard, and prevented a close to miss.
